RU.26/0576 Granted
71 A Harpesford Avenue Virginia Water Surrey GU25 4RG
T1 - Oak at front - fell - tree has Acute Oak Decline (AOD) The tree is in advanced decline, almost dead, due AOD evidenced by weeping exudates on the main stem and progressive and advanced canopy dieback monitored over 5+ years. Structural integrity and vitality are now significantly compromised. Given its proximity to the dwelling and highway (high target occupancy), retention presents an unacceptable foreseeable risk of failure and liability under duty of care obligations. Felling is therefore justified on arboricultural safety grounds.
